Staffare partner with Hyundai to help strengthen Swedish construction equipment market

HYUNDAI Construction Equipment have announced the appointment of Staffare to help strengthen the Swedish construction market. This collaboration marks a significant milestone in Staffare’s four-decade legacy of machinery distribution within Sweden’s agricultural, contracting, and earthmoving sectors.

Hyundai’s comprehensive product portfolio – including hydraulic excavators ranging from 0.8 to 100 tonnes, wheel loaders and articulated dumptrucks – aligns precisely with Staffare’s strategic objectives.

 

‘Historically, our contracting division has focused on machines up to 12 tonnes,’ said Thomas Svederus, sales manager at Staffare. ‘We have long sought a partner offering an extensive excavator range, and Hyundai fulfil this requirement with distinction.’

Since formalizing the partnership on 1 April, Staffare have executed their inaugural sales –three wheeled excavators – and released a series of competitive offers. In the coming months, the company will intensify its customer engagement efforts, presenting Hyundai’s complete product suite across all 11 Staffare locations nationwide.

Hyundai’s existing Swedish fleet is predominantly concentrated in Stockholm and Gothenburg. Leveraging Staffare’s entrenched presence in northern Sweden, the partnership aims to broaden market penetration throughout the country.

‘We approach this endeavour with both humility and resolute commitment,’ continued Mr Svederus. ‘While challenges are inevitable, the prospects for mutual success with Hyundai are exceptionally promising.’

Concurrent with their sales expansion, Staffare are recruiting additional Hyundai-dedicated sales personnel in Gothenburg and Stockholm. A fleet of demonstration machines is en route to support hands-on customer evaluation, while service continuity for existing Hyundai equipment will be maintained in co-operation with former importers EMS and Stig Machine until 31 December 2025.

Effective 1 January 2026, Staffare will assume full responsibility for aftermarket services and spare-parts logistics for all Hyundai machines in Sweden.

‘Hyundai is a globally respected brand with a robust product pipeline,’ concluded Mr Svederus. ‘We are honoured to represent Hyundai in Sweden and are eager to advance our shared vision for the Swedish construction industry.’
